Cloudflare, a leading internet security and performance company, often employs advanced security measures to protect websites from malicious activities. Such actions may result in temporary blocks for users, raising questions about why these measures are taken and how they can be resolved. This article seeks to provide insight into the mechanisms that trigger these restrictions and possible ways for individuals to address them.### Understanding Temporary BlocksCloudflare's security systems can detect suspicious behavior or specific inputs that might pose a threat to websites protected by their services. When users perform actions that are flagged as potentially harmful, such as submitting certain keywords, attempting SQL injections, or providing malformed data, these systems may activate to prevent potential breaches. This protective mechanism is designed to safeguard the integrity of the website and its user database.### What Triggers These Restrictions?The triggers for temporary blocks can vary widely but commonly include:- Specific Keywords: Entering particular words or phrases that might be used in cyberattacks.- SQL Commands: Attempting to inject SQL code into web forms, which is a common method for hackers to extract data or execute unauthorized operations.- Malformed Data: Submitting incorrect or improperly formatted data through web interfaces, which could disrupt the website's functionality.### How to Resolve Temporary BlocksIf you encounter a temporary block while accessing a Cloudflare-protected website:1. Contact the Site Owner: Reach out to the website administrator via email to inform them about the block. Explain what actions led to the restriction and any relevant details such as the Cloudflare Ray ID found at the bottom of the page.2. Clarify Your Intentions: Ensure that your actions were not intended to cause harm or bypass security measures. Providing context can help the site owner assess whether a false positive occurred.3. Follow Security Guidelines: To avoid future restrictions, familiarize yourself with best practices for interacting with websites, such as refraining from submitting suspicious data and adhering to web form guidelines.Cloudflare's temporary blocks serve an essential purpose in safeguarding online platforms against cyber threats. By understanding the reasons behind these measures and taking appropriate steps when encountering them, users can contribute positively to internet security.
